Understanding Annual Phlox Flowers
Annual phlox, also known as Drummond’s phlox (Phlox drummondii), is a popular flowering plant that produces clusters of colorful blooms in shades of pink, purple, red, and white. These vibrant flowers are prized for their long-lasting blooms and ability to attract pollinators like butterflies and hummingbirds.
Annual phlox is typically grown as an annual in most climates, meaning it completes its life cycle within a single growing season. It prefers full sun to partial shade and well-drained soil. Spacing Guidelines for Annual Phlox Flowers
The ideal spacing between each annual phlox flower depends on several factors, including the variety of phlox, the size of the mature plant, and your aesthetic preferences. As a general guideline, aim to space annual phlox plants approximately 12 to 18 inches apart.
-
Variety: Different varieties of annual phlox may have varying growth habits and mature sizes. Some varieties may produce compact plants that require closer spacing, while others may sprawl or spread out more, necessitating wider spacing.
-
Mature Size: Consider the expected mature size of the phlox plant when determining spacing. Larger varieties that grow taller or wider will need more room between plants to allow for proper growth and maintenance.
-
Aesthetic Appeal: Spacing can also be influenced by your desired aesthetic outcome. If you want a dense, full look with minimal gaps between plants, you may opt for closer spacing. Alternatively, wider spacing can create a more open and airy appearance in the garden.

Benefits of Properly Spaced Annual Phlox Flowers
Ensuring proper spacing between each annual phlox flower offers several benefits that contribute to the overall health and beauty of your garden:
-
Optimal Growth: Adequate spacing allows each plant to access sufficient sunlight, water, and nutrients for healthy growth and abundant flowering.
-
Air Circulation: Properly spaced plants promote good air circulation around the foliage, reducing humidity levels and minimizing the risk of fungal diseases like powdery mildew.
-
Aesthetically Pleasing: Well-spaced plants create a visually appealing garden layout with room for individual plants to showcase their blooms without being overshadowed by neighboring plants.
-
Ease of Maintenance: Proper spacing makes it easier to access and care for each plant, including watering, fertilizing, and pruning tasks.
